RealTime DC signs first customer in Middle East
RealTime DC has signed its first customer in the Middle East region, Accuro ME. The recent FM Expo in Dubai was RealTime DC’s first steps to introducing its mobile data capture solutions to the United Arab Emirates and to the Middle East as a whole. Accuro are going to be using the Maximiser quality monitoring solution as of September 2009. Maximiser, which is currently used by a third of NHS trusts, is a highly effective handheld quality monitoring software solution providing a structured approach to quality monitoring against any service level. Used to support inspections against any criteria and scoring system, Maximiser allows you to conduct live quality monitoring inspections, collect comments, signatures and images as you go, saving unnecessary administration and re-keying for further analysis. Maximiser has been designed to undertake any number of inspections and is suitable for any industry that needs to regularly qualify a service standard.
Accuro will be using Maximiser as an integral part of the service they are delivering to the Welcare Hospital in Garhoud. By using Maximiser, Accuro will be sure that they are providing the best possible service and will be able to use this to prove the service levels that they are offering to their customer. Accuro will be rolling Maximiser out to other hospitals in the future.
